**Ticket: Fontloft vault locked — vendored fonts blocked**

The Grindlewick font vault auto-locked after the license audit. Plugin authors can't vendor the Marrowtype family until it's unsealed. Don't re-fetch from upstream; use the vendored copies only. Unseal the vault with the passphrase below.

vault phrase of yawig-bawig = fenael-norael-eliox-gilox-casath-druath-zorys-istwyn-jorwyn

## Stricter SQL linting for plugin-contributed migrations

Hey plugin folks — this PR tightens the Lintquill rules that run against any `.sql` file your plugin ships. Mostly it's the obvious stuff: keyword casing, no `SELECT *` in views, and a hard cap on statement length. Nothing should break existing plugins unless you were already on thin ice. Autofix covers about 80% of violations, so run the fixer before filing issues. The new rule thresholds are as follows.

tuning table, kahop-fafog:
CAPS = {
    "gilael": 682,
    "ralael": 264,
}

The guest Wi-Fi desk sits to the left of the main reception counter in the Oakhaven Building. Facilities staff should unlock the desk drawer each morning, check the printed network leaflets are stocked, and relock it at close. To open the drawer's keypad lock, use the code provided below.

turnstile pass: bdg-FVNQRS-72965873

## Relevance Tuning Notes

Marrowlight's search ranker blends lexical score, freshness decay, and a click-through prior. Reviewers: any change to one weight shifts the effective scale of the others, so PRs must adjust them together and attach offline NDCG numbers. The decay half-life is the most sensitive knob; small edits swing recent-content visibility sharply. The weights under review are these.

tuning table, kajog-kawef:
PRIORITIES = {
    "kelox": 870,
    "kasix": 89,
    "eliax": 988,
}